Soneet R. Kapila Named ABI President-Elect

Alexandria, Va. — The American Bankruptcy Institute (ABI) announces that Soneet R. Kapila of KapilaMukamal, LLP (Fort Lauderdale, Fla.) has been selected by the ABI Board of Directors to be President-Elect. He will become president for a one-year term, starting at ABI’s 2023 Annual Spring Meeting. An ABI member since 1994, Kapila was recently ABI’s Treasurer, a co-chair of ABI’s Southeast Bankruptcy Workshop and a contributing author to ABI’s Fraud and Forensics: Piercing Through the Deception in a Commercial Fraud Case, and he is a regular speaker at ABI events and a contributor to the ABI Anthony H.N. Schnelling Endowment Fund.

Kapila is a founding partner of KapilaMukamal, LLP (formerly Kapila & Co.). For over 20 years, he has concentrated his efforts in the areas of insolvency, fiduciary and creditors’ rights matters. He represents other bankruptcy trustees, debtors, and both secured and unsecured creditors in and out of bankruptcy court. Kapila is a Fellow in the American College of Bankruptcy, and he has been named one of the Power Leaders in Law and Accounting by the South Florida Business Journal and Best Trustee by the Daily Business Review’s “Best of 2012.” In addition, the South Florida Business Journal honored him with its Key Partners Award. Kapila received his M.B.A. from the Cranfield School of Management Studies in England.

ABI is the largest multi-disciplinary, nonpartisan organization dedicated to research and education on matters related to insolvency. ABI was founded in 1982 to provide Congress and the public with unbiased analysis of bankruptcy issues. The ABI membership includes nearly 11,000 attorneys, accountants, bankers, judges, professors, lenders, turnaround specialists and other bankruptcy professionals, providing a forum for the exchange of ideas and information.
